Down the Pils
Bohemian Pilsener • All Grain • 5 gal

Ingredients (All Grain, 5 gal)
- 8 lbs
Belgian Pils

Pilsner style malted barley grain.
- 1 lbs
German Vienna

Increases malty flavor, provides balance. Use in Vienna, Märzen and Oktoberfest.
- .5 lbs
Munich Malt

Sweet, toasted flavor and aroma. For Oktoberfests and malty styles
- .5 lbs
Belgian Cara-Pils

Significantly increases foam/head retention and body of the beer.
- 1 oz
Cluster - 7.9 AA% pellets; boiled 60 min

Used for bittering and flavor qualities in light and dark American lagers. Aroma is very floral.
- .5 oz
Saaz - 5.9 AA% pellets; boiled 15 min

Used for finishing pilseners, continental lagers, and wheats. The aroma is spicy and pleasant with fragrant overtones.
- 0.50 oz
Saaz - 5.9 AA% pellets; boiled 1 min

Used for finishing pilseners, continental lagers, and wheats. The aroma is spicy and pleasant with fragrant overtones.
-
Wyeast 2007 Pilsen Lager™

A classic American pilsner strain, smooth, malty palate. Ferments dry and crisp.
Style (BJCP)
Category: 2 - Pilsner
Subcategory: B - Bohemian Pilsener
| Range for this Style | |||
|---|---|---|---|
| Original Gravity: | 1.050 | 1.044 - 1.056 | |
| Terminal Gravity: | 1.015 | 1.013 - 1.017 | |
| Color: | 5.2 SRM | 3.5 - 6 | |
| Alcohol: | 4.6% ABV | 4.2% - 5.4% | |
| Bitterness: | 44.3 IBU | 35 - 45 |
